BETA experiments on melt-concrete interaction: the role of zirconium and the potential sump water contact during core melt-down accidents

In the BETA test facility of Kernforschungszentrum Karlsruhe, prototypical core melts can be simulated in concrete structures sufficient in size to allow a computer-code-assisted extrapolation to be made to the reactor geometry.
